Janko
Janko is a village located in Bandgaon subdivision of Pashchimi Singhbhum district in Jharkhand, India. It is situated 41km away from sub-district headquarter Bandagano (tehsildar office) and 46km away from district headquarter Charebasa. As per 2009 stats, Nakti is the gram panchayat of Janko village.

About Janko
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Janko is 377189. The village spans a total geographical area of 562 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 835216. Bandgaon is nearest town to Janko village for all major economic activities.
When it comes to local governance, Janko village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Chakradharpur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Singhbhum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Janko
Below is a concise population overview of Janko as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 924 | 456 | 468 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 130 | 59 | 71 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 921 | 455 | 466 |
Literate Population | 317 | 182 | 135 |
Illiterate Population | 607 | 274 | 333 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Janko village:
- The total population of Janko village is around 924, including approximately 456 males and 468 females, with a sex ratio of 1026 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 130 children aged 0–6 years in Janko village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Janko village has 921 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Janko village is about 34.31%, with male literacy at 39.91% and female literacy at 28.85%.
- There are around 178 households in Janko village.
Connectivity of Janko
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Janko. As per the 2011 stats, Janko had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
